Default Installing aftermarket radio, Do I really need the dash kit?

I have a 1995 Acura Integra, It looks like a simple remove & replace kind of deal since the stock radio already have the lower pocket. All you have to do is put a new radio in right?

Do I really have to spend $20 and buy the radio kit? I know I have to buy the radio harness though.

Default Re: Installing aftermarket radio, Do I really need the dash kit?

If you don't have the dash kit or the cage around the unit it's gonna sit in there all sloppy since the aftermarket unit is usually just a hair smaller than the stock unit. So that means its gonna sit all crooked and come sliding out of there and nail you in the hand everytime you hit that maaad v-tak.

So will it work without the dash kit? Yea
